  • Publication number: 20110223491
    Abstract: Provided is a composite material having spinel structured lithium titanate, wherein the lithium titanate has a microcrystalline grain diameter of about 36-43 nm and an average particle diameter of about 1-3 ?m. The composite material comprises a small amount of TiO2 and Li2—TiO3 impurity phases. Also provided is a method for preparing the composite material, which comprises the steps: mixing titanium dioxide particles and soluble lithium sources with water to form a mixture, removing water and then sintering the mixture in an inert gas at a constant temperature, and cooling the sintered mixture, wherein the titanium dioxide particles have D50 of not greater than 0.4 ?m and D95 of less than 1 ?m. Further provided are a negative active substance comprising the composite material and a lithium ion secondary battery containing the negative active substance.

  • Patent number: 7283230
    Abstract: A semiconductor forensic light kit is disclosed. The forensic light kit may use a variety of semiconductor light sources to produce light that contrasts forensic evidence against its background for viewing, photographing and collection. Example semiconductor light sources for the forensic light kit include light emitting diodes and laser chips. A heat sink, thermoelectric cooler and fan may be included to keep the forensic light cool. Removable light source heads may be included on the forensic light kit to provide for head swapping to give the user access to different wavelengths of light.

  • Publication number: 20060042182
    Abstract: A method of fixing support means disposed within an evacuated glass pane, said evacuated glass panel includes at least two planar glass sheets having any shape, and support means disposed therein, said fixing method including following steps: at first apply a solution layer on surface of planar glass sheet, on which the support means is disposed; secondly, place the support means on said solution layer; at last cover the upper surface of support means with a planar glass sheet, and heat said solution layer to dry, so as to fix said support means between planar glass sheets. The present invention by way of fixing the support means on surface of planar glass sheet through adhesion to reduce or entirely overcame the movement of support means between planar glass sheets, thereby increase the mechanical strength and improve the quality of evacuated glass panel.
